aboutsummaryrefslogtreecommitdiffstats
path: root/target/linux/sunxi/modules.mk
Commit message (Collapse)AuthorAgeFilesLines
* Revert "sunxi: add rtc-sun6i driver package"Daniel Golle2021-11-211-18/+0
| | | | | | | sun6i-rtc is a builtin_platform_driver and cannot be built as a module. Hence this reverts commit e178d9a5494747a9b6ea34f2fc9e798b4b1ecc16. Signed-off-by: Daniel Golle <daniel@makrotopia.org>
* sunxi: add rtc-sun6i driver packageZhao Yu2021-11-201-0/+18
| | | | | | | | | | | | | | | | | | | | | | | | | | | | AP6212 wifi need wifi_pwrseq, but from OrangePi Lite 2 dts : wifi_pwrseq: wifi_pwrseq { compatible = "mmc-pwrseq-simple"; clocks = <&rtc 1>; clock-names = "ext_clock"; reset-gpios = <&r_pio 1 3 GPIO_ACTIVE_LOW>; /* PM3 */ post-power-on-delay-ms = <200>; }; this pwrseq need rtc clock, or kernel won't find this device. but now rtc-sunxi.c only support A10/A20. Orangepi Lite 2 use H6 ,from rtc-sun6i.c show compatible is { .compatible = "allwinner,sun6i-a31-rtc" }, { .compatible = "allwinner,sun8i-a23-rtc" }, { .compatible = "allwinner,sun8i-h3-rtc" }, { .compatible = "allwinner,sun8i-r40-rtc" }, { .compatible = "allwinner,sun8i-v3-rtc" }, { .compatible = "allwinner,sun50i-h5-rtc" }, { .compatible = "allwinner,sun50i-h6-rtc" }, So it need this to let kernel find this mmc wifi device. As suggested by hauke, let it build as package. Signed-off-by: Zhao Yu <574249312@qq.com>
* target: use SPDX license identifiers on MakefilesAdrian Schmutzler2021-02-101-3/+1
| | | | | | Use SPDX license tags to allow machines to check licenses. Signed-off-by: Adrian Schmutzler <freifunk@adrianschmutzler.de>
* sunxi: add a kmod package for sun4i_spdifAndre Heider2020-10-111-1/+15
| | | | | | | | | | | | Tested on a A20 board: $ cat /proc/asound/cards 0 [SPDIF ]: On-board_SPDIF - On-board SPDIF On-board SPDIF Size of the module for a 32bit kernel: 60708 linux-5.4.66/sound/soc/sunxi/sun4i-spdif.ko Signed-off-by: Andre Heider <a.heider@gmail.com>
* sunxi: fix build of rtc package when module not availableHauke Mehrtens2017-09-181-2/+2
| | | | | | | If the Kconfig option CONFIG_RTC_DRV_SUNXI is not selected this package should be be build.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
* sunxi: clean up modules definitionsMatthias Schiffer2017-05-041-43/+3
| | | | | | | | | | | | | | | | | | Module definitions for kmod-wdt-sunxi and kmod-eeprom-sunxi are removed (wdt-sunxi was builtin anyways; nvmem-sunxi, which is the new name of eeprom-sunxi is changed to builtin). As kmod-eeprom-sunxi was specified in DEFAULT_PACKAGES, but not available on kernel 4.4, it was breaking the image builder. Support for kmod-sunxi-ir is added for kernel 4.4 (it is unclear why it was disable before, it builds fine with with kernel 4.4). Condtionals only relevant for pre-4.4 kernels are removed from modules.mk, as sunxi does't support older kernels anymore. Fixes FS#755. Signed-off-by: Matthias Schiffer <mschiffer@universe-factory.net>
* sunxi: prep module support options for 4.4Zoltan Herpai2016-01-091-8/+14
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 48160
* sunxi: add audio module for 4.1Zoltan Herpai2015-08-211-0/+17
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 46704
* sunxi: reorganize kmod-ata-sunxi dependenciesZoltan Herpai2015-08-211-4/+2
| | | | | | Signed-off-by: Daniel Golle <daniel@makrotopia.org> SVN-Revision: 46702
* sunxi: add sunxi-ir moduleZoltan Herpai2014-09-211-0/+20
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 42631
* target/sunxi: add dependency on sunxi to kmod-wdt-sunxiNicolas Thill2014-02-221-0/+1
| | | | SVN-Revision: 39693
* sunxi: various fixes - DT: update USB vbus from 3.3v to 5v - emac: add ↵Zoltan Herpai2014-01-061-0/+15
| | | | | | | | | | missing free_irq - DT: add emac aliases - DT: fix interrupts on A20 - modules: add watchdog module - don't compile in mac80211 - don't compile in usbnet Thanks to Hans de Goede, Zalan Blenessy et al.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39204
* sunxi: emac changes - move emac into module - add into profiles where ↵Zoltan Herpai2014-01-041-0/+12
| | | | | | | | appropriate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39200
* sunxi: add sata driver for sun[47]iZoltan Herpai2014-01-041-0/+16
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39197
* sunxi: move sunxi-sid (security ID) off to moduleZoltan Herpai2014-01-041-0/+16
| | | | | |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39196
* sunxi: move rtc off to moduleZoltan Herpai2014-01-041-0/+24
Signed-off-by: Zoltan HERPAI <wigyori@uid0.hu> SVN-Revision: 39195